  • Programmable 24-Hour On/Off Timer
  • Works with Amazon Alexa & The Google Assistant
  • 6-way directional airflow and three different fan speeds
  • 8,000 BTU Model is recommended for rooms up to 350 sq ft
  • 10,000 BTU Model is recommended for rooms up to 450 sq ft
  • 12,000 BTU Model is recommended for rooms up to 550 sq ft

Second this. I installed a regular window AC in one room and a Midea/Danby U shaped one in another room (both sliding windows).

The Midea U shaped one is way better and the 12k BTU Midea unit is about the same size the as the 8k BTU Midea unit and only uses 475 W on high fan mode.

The regular AC one uses around 600-700W and sounds like a blower while the Midea sounds like a room fan. In fact sometimes I don't even know the U shaped ones are even on. It's like a minisplit for Windows.

If you don't want to build a frame, just get the Soleus window frame kit and it works with the Midea/Danby U shaped units. Switching out the regular AC in the other room with another Midea/Danby.

Quote from mikebacker :
I don't understand why support for people with homes that have sliding windows is so poor. I rarely see vertical window ACs, and if I do, it's 2x-3x the price of a standard window ac, though the vast majority of homes I've lived and visited in seem to have these windows.

Maybe it's geographical, but it's ridiculous that manufacturers can't seem to be bothered to design more vertical window acs, relegating people in my situation to use a terribly inefficient portable ac instead. Ugh
Is it really that different? I understand it's a bit less stable, but that's what's going to happen even with "vertical" window ACs, right? Unless somehow the ac unit is the same height as the sliding window, you still have to find a way to fill that gap above it. So just get a piece of plexiglass and 2x4s to brace it all. It'll probably be cheaper than putting it in a single-hung window with the brace that the a/c manufacturer sells separately.
